Zambia U17 Women’s team prepare for South Africa Assignment

Under-17 Women National Team coach Kangwa Kaluba says his lasses are highly motivated by the prospect of FIFA World Cup qualification.

In an interview, Kaluba whose team minted bronze at the 2019 Cosafa Women Championship in Mauritius said the girls would not be under pressure to replicate the 2014 FIFA World Cup feat by their counterparts but would fight to write their own story.

“We are not under pressure to replicate the 2014 achievement. This is a new project and every project has its own target,” he said.

Kaluba said the team was focused on getting over the South Africa challenge that lay ahead on February 28.

“South Africa is very beatable so we are preparing our girls to give their best during that assignment,” he said.

Zambia will host South Africa next Friday before the March 14 away fixture in the India 2020 FIFA World Cup qualifiers.
